Jobs that come up a lot

A toilet that keeps running can easily waste 200 litres of water a day. It’s usually the float or the rubber seal in the cistern, a part that costs a few euros.

A new mixer tap in the kitchen, an outside tap for the garden, plumbing in the washing machine in the attic: all of them a morning’s work.

Questions about plumbing

Can I choose the tap myself?

Yes. Do watch the connection, because not every new tap fits an old worktop straight away. Send a photo of what’s there now and Peter will take a look.

Do you work on gas?

No. Gas pipes and the boiler Peter leaves to a registered installer.
